Output 323913937697ab7eb0fbcc3d4727834a42c88d9897c99c0dcbeeb29d140b7e1a:32

value
31677982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1e84c59c9b8f8ba7ba6616363bf83a342c6922 OP_EQUAL
address
MEvvpg1ggdqsxKtAHQHFW4p5nMdzZS3t4E
transaction
323913937697ab7eb0fbcc3d4727834a42c88d9897c99c0dcbeeb29d140b7e1a
spent
true